Package: gearmand / 1.0.6-9

Metadata

Package Version Patches format
gearmand 1.0.6-9 3.0 (quilt)

Patch series

view the series file
Patch File delta Description
disable_vcs.patch | (download)

m4/ax_vcs_checkout.m4 | 4 0 + 4 - 0 !
1 file changed, 4 deletions(-)

 disable vcs check
syntax_corrections.patch | (download)

gearmand/gearmand.cc | 4 2 + 2 - 0 !
libgearman-server/gearmand.cc | 2 1 + 1 - 0 !
libgearman-server/gearmand_con.cc | 2 1 + 1 - 0 !
libgearman-server/plugins/queue/drizzle/queue.cc | 2 1 + 1 - 0 !
libgearman-server/server.cc | 2 1 + 1 - 0 !
libgearman/client.cc | 4 2 + 2 - 0 !
libgearman/do.cc | 4 2 + 2 - 0 !
libtest/server_container.cc | 2 1 + 1 - 0 !
man/gearman_client_job_status.3 | 2 1 + 1 - 0 !
man/gearman_continue.3 | 2 1 + 1 - 0 !
man/gearman_failed.3 | 2 1 + 1 - 0 !
man/gearman_return_t.3 | 2 1 + 1 - 0 !
man/gearman_strerror.3 | 2 1 + 1 - 0 !
man/gearman_success.3 | 2 1 + 1 - 0 !
man/gearmand.8 | 2 1 + 1 - 0 !
util/instance.cc | 2 1 + 1 - 0 !
util/pidfile.cc | 2 1 + 1 - 0 !
17 files changed, 20 insertions(+), 20 deletions(-)

 fix typos detected by lintian
0001 Bug 715322 gearmand FTBFS on hurd i386.patch | (download)

libtest/timer.cc | 4 2 + 2 - 0 !
1 file changed, 2 insertions(+), 2 deletions(-)

 [patch] bug#715322: gearmand: ftbfs on hurd-i386

Source: gearmand
Version: 1.0.6-1
Severity: important
Tags: patch
User: debian-hurd@lists.debian.org
Usertags: hurd
Control: forwarded -1 https://bugs.launchpad.net/gearmand/+bug/1198739

Hi,

gearmand 1.0.6 fails to compile on GNU/Hurd [1].

The problem is the misuse of the __MACH__ define for what really is code
specific to Mac OS X (both Hurd and Mac OS X use a (micro)kernel based
on Mach, hence the usage of __MACH__).

I reported upstream [2] a bug about this with a patch for the latest
1.1.8 also fixing a couple of tests; since tests are not executed in
the Debian build, attached there is a reduced version of the patch which
just fixes the build.

[1] https://buildd.debian.org/status/fetch.php?pkg=gearmand&ver=1.0.6-1&arch=hurd-i386&stamp=1373229741
[2] https://bugs.launchpad.net/gearmand/+bug/1198739

Thanks,
--
Pino

0002 bugfix endless loop on http bad request or bad metho.patch | (download)

libgearman-server/plugins/protocol/http/protocol.cc | 4 2 + 2 - 0 !
1 file changed, 2 insertions(+), 2 deletions(-)

 fix endless loop on bad http request
 Date: Tue, 6 Jan 2015 08:39:53 +0100
Bug: https://bugs.launchpad.net/gearmand/+bug/1348865
Bug-Debian: https://bugs.debian.org/774143
gcc5.diff | (download)

m4/boost.m4 | 2 1 + 1 - 0 !
1 file changed, 1 insertion(+), 1 deletion(-)

 fix build with gcc 5, calling cpp with -p